    摘要: A first projection is formed on the outer periphery of a bulb part, a second projection is formed on the socket rear end of the bulb part, a tapered part is formed with a decreasing diameter from the inner periphery of a heel part to the inner periphery of the second projection, and a third projection is formed on the tapered part. A first dimension B from the first projection to the third projection in an inclination direction opposite to an inclination direction G of the tapered part is smaller than a second dimension C from the first projection to the second projection in a radial direction A.

    摘要: A pipe joint structure provided with: a heel section configured so that a spigot formed on the end section of a pipe is inserted via a seal member into a socket formed in the end section of another pipe and seal member is fitted to a recessed section formed on the inner circumferential section of the socket; and a valve section compressed between the inner circumferential surface of the socket and the outer circumferential surface of the spigot. Additionally, a marker member is provided to the heel section that is accommodated in the recessed section. The socket circumference section of the pipe joint structure is subjected to non-contact inspection by a marker detection device from the spigot-side pipe along the axial direction of the pipe and the quality of the joining state of the pipe joint structure is determined on the basis of whether the marker member is detected.
